Threadneedle hires JPM's Grant for US equities team

J.P. Morgan Asset Management's Nadia Grant is to join Threadneedle as part of its US equities team, headed by Cormac Weldon.

Grant, who worked on a number of portfolios at JPMAM as part of the Multi-Strategy Solutions team, will join Threadneedle as a fund manager on 3 February. The appointment is subject to regulatory approval. Based in London, she will report to head of US equities Weldon (pictured). Grant's hire brings Threadneedle's US equities team headcount to ten, encompassing four fund managers and six analysts. Her move follows a 15-year stint at J.P. Morgan, encompassing roles in JPMAM's US equity team and at J.P. Morgan Private Bank.
